Thank you. On the first I did a bottom to top gradient to lift the exposure in the weeds and then decreased the luminance of the sky to make it more blue.

Quote:
Originally Posted by martha36 View Post
I really like these image. They are simple, yet complex. I especially like the second one - the lighting is very nice.
Thanks. On the second one I did a split toning on it and then desaturated it a bit.
